Historical Context: Russia and the Hemp Legacy

Long before the present international trend toward legalization and medicinal usage, Russia was an international leader in the production of industrial hemp. During Лучший каннабис в России and 19th centuries, the Russian Empire was the primary supplier of hemp fiber to the world, supplying necessary materials for the world's navies. This custom continued into the Soviet era, where the USSR when represented over 50% of the world's hemp cultivation.

While the "War on Drugs" in the late 20th century reshaped the landscape, the genetic footprint of these plants stays. Particularly, Russia is the ancestral home of Cannabis ruderalis, a sturdy subspecies that has actually ended up being the backbone of contemporary "autoflowering" cannabis genes.

The Resilience of Russian Genetics: Cannabis Ruderalis

One can not go over cannabis seeds in Russia without discussing Cannabis ruderalis. Coming from in the severe climates of Southern Russia, Central Asia, and Eastern Europe, this subspecies adapted to make it through brief summers and freezing temperatures.

Key Characteristics of Ruderalis:

  • Autoflowering: Unlike Sativa or Indica, which require a change in the light cycle to bloom, Ruderalis flowers based on age.
  • Strength: Highly resistant to bugs, molds, and temperature changes.
  • Stature: Typically little and rugged, rarely going beyond 60-80 cm in height.
  • Low THC: Naturally includes extremely low levels of THC however high levels of CBD.

Modern seed banks worldwide make use of these Russian "landrace" genes to develop autoflowering hybrids, which are popular in regions with brief growing seasons, such as Northern Europe and Canada.

The Industrial Hemp Renaissance

While "leisure" seeds are a niche market, the commercial hemp seed industry in Russia is experiencing a significant rebirth. The Russian government has licensed the cultivation of particular hemp varieties that contain less than 0.1% THC.

Uses for Industrial Seeds:

  • Hemp Seed Oil: Rich in Omega-3 and Omega-6 fats, used in cooking and cosmetics.
  • Hemp Hearts: High-protein food supplements.
  • Fiber Production: For textiles, eco-friendly building products (hempcrete), and paper.

Present Russian agricultural policy encourages the advancement of domestic seed banks to lower dependence on foreign imports and to renew the rural economy.

4. What is "Ruderalis"?

Cannabis ruderalis is a subspecies of cannabis native to Russia and Eastern Europe. It is unique since it flowers immediately based upon age rather than light cycles, a trait used to create all contemporary autoflowering stress.

5. Is commercial hemp the same as cannabis?

No. Industrial hemp refers to cannabis varieties bred particularly for fiber, oil, and seeds with a THC content of less than 0.1% (in Russia). It does not produce a psychoactive effect.
